LAHORE: The Supreme Court could strike down any law contrary to the spirit of the Constitution, said Justice (retired) Khalilur Rehman Ramday on Friday. He was addressing the members of the Lahore Bar Association at Aiwan-i-Adl. Justice Ramday asked politicians not to mislead the nation and said the parliament cannot make any law that violated fundamental rights of citizens or Islamic injunctions. He said the 2007-2008 lawyers’ movement wasn’t about reinstatement of judges but was “for the supremacy of law”.
